2017-12-23 14 views
0

私はAzureで動作するMVCベースのWebアプリケーションを持っています。 CPUパフォーマンスは過去5カ月間に非常に予測可能でした。しかし、過去24時間、最近では東部時間午後1時から午後1時30分まで、今日、米国ではCPUスパイクが100%に近づいています。下の画像は過去7日間のものです。珍しいAzureスローダウンで問題を検出する方法

enter image description here

このCPUスパイクは自分のアプリケーションや私のユーザーから来ていません。ユーザー、ユーザーのアクティビティまたはクエリが異常に増加していません。また、Googleアナリティクスをチェックして、自分のサイトがランダムなユーザーなどに叩かれていたかどうかを確認しました。

非常に珍しい私のサイトから出て行くデータにも相当に大きなジャンプがありました。 2番目の画像は過去1週間のデータ出力を示します。しかし、私が言ったように、私はAzure SQL Database Query Storeを調べましたが、それはまったく普通のものではありません。さらに、私のDTUのパーセンテージはこの間に決して100%にも達しませんでした。これは、この多くのデータがデータベースから引き出された場合には確かにありました。

enter image description here

は、私は基本的に私の最後に間違って何かを除外しています。これを引き起こしているAzureに問題があったかどうか確認する方法はありますか?

+1

あなたはAzureプラットフォーム自体に何かがこの問題を引き起こしていたかどうかを確認することができる2つの方法があります:1:https://azure.microsoft.com/en-us/status/を確認してくださいが。これは、現在、特定のサービスのある地域にアクティブインシデントがあるかどうかを示します。このページの[ステータス履歴]リンクをクリックして、過去に何かが起こったかどうかを確認することもできます。私があなたが言及した期間中にチェックし、何も列挙されなかった。 2:Azureでサポートチケットを開きます。 –

答えて

1

基礎となるAzureプラットフォームの問題が疑われる場合は、Azure Service HealthとAzure Resource Healthの両方が、プラットフォームの問題による影響を受けるかどうかを判断するのに役立つリソースです。

Azure Service Healthは、Azureプラットフォームの問題がお客様のリソースに影響を与えると、パーソナライズされたサービス正常性情報を提供します。

https://docs.microsoft.com/en-us/azure/service-health/service-health-overview

Azureのリソースの健全性は、あなたのAzureのリソースが健康または不健康であるかどうかに可視性を提供します。サポートAzureのリソースのリストについては

https://docs.microsoft.com/en-us/azure/service-health/resource-health-overview

、あなたも行われている健康診断のセットを記述し、この記事を参照することができます。

https://docs.microsoft.com/en-us/azure/service-health/resource-health-checks-resource-types

関連する問題